The Downfall of Honda
Honda…oh how the mighty have fallen. As many of you know, I often like to wax nostalgic about my car obsessed youth. Although I grew up during two great hypercar wars, I also grew up, and started driving, during the greatest tuner car war since the 1960’s.
With the death of the NSX, Honda has one “sport” model in its lineup. The Civic Si. Honda’s traditional lineup is still made of good, competitive, cars (besides the Ridgeline of course). Acura’s lineup, while good, is arguably not competitive. Acura, while ostensibly a “luxury” brand, does not offer an engine with much over 300 horsepower, a V-8 or RWD. The majority of Acura’s lineup is simply rebadged Honda’s. Luxury consumers are not stupid, for the most part, especially on the high end, they know a pretender when they see one.
